Andrej Karpathy on autoresearch with an untrusted pool of workers: "My designs that incorporate an untrusted pool of workers (into autoresearch) actually look a little bit like a blockchain. Instead of blocks, you have commits, and these commits can build on each other and contain changes to the code as you're improving it. The proof of work is basically doing tons of experimentation to find the commits that work." The idea that distributed & permissionless autoresearch ~= proof-of-useful-work remains a high-level intuition for now, but it is extremely intriguing to say the least. most investors misunderstand the Google Genie launch the real opportunity isn't recreating Fortnite or GTA - it's the emergence of an entirely new storytelling medium, on par with the first film, comics, or short-form video world models won't build traditional AAA video games anytime soon. games today are deterministic: predefined rules, scripted events, fixed logic. you go to the bank and a robbery happens, squeeze a trigger and the gun does X damage etc. multiplayer games like Fortnite require 100 clients to agree on the same state, frame by frame world models like Genie are different. they're probabilistic - the next frame is inferred, not scripted. neither player nor developer knows exactly what will happen until it does. that makes them poorly suited for traditional games. the generations also have a delay, are expensive, and hard to control (as of today) however, world models also have unique strengths: - deep personalization - an infinite canvas - integration with coding / creative agents - radically lower barrier (and blank slate) for new creators instead of forcing world models into existing game formats, imagine a new storytelling medium built around these strengths: - Dune fans stepping into Arrakis to retrace Muad'dib's journey - Game of Thrones fans creating alternate endings with friends - Niche literary genres like Lovecraftian romance or alternative military history exploding into pop culture - 100M+ fan fiction writers building worlds to illustrate their rich imaginations - Film students breaking out with immersive documentaries about exotic places / people in the world most of us will never visit we're just at the beginning of this journey. models are improving quickly. control layers, editing workflows, creator tools still need to get built - but they will come i believe there's a rare opportunity in the near future for the right team - blending creatives and technologists - to build a Pixar for this new storytelling medium. just as Pixar unlocked new types of stories through computer graphics, world models / interactive video could unlock a new category of interactive experiences we can't yet fully predict today for more detail, check out our earlier blog on this 👇
